Meet David

Clean government. Smart growth.

David Lee is a licensed civil engineer who spent fifteen years designing the roads, bridges, and water systems his neighbors use every day. He served two terms on the planning board, where he built a reputation for asking hard questions and reading every page.

He's running for County Commission to make decisions in the open, fund only what we can afford, and treat taxpayer dollars like the privilege they are.
